The Malteserkirche, or Maltese Church, is a Roman Catholic church located on Kärntner Straße in Vienna's Innere Stadt. While smaller and less ornate than many of Vienna’s famous churches like St. Stephen's, it holds historical significance as the spiritual home of the Knights of Malta in Vienna. The church features emblems and flags associated with the Order of Malta and offers a tranquil atmosphere amidst the bustling city. It is known for hosting intimate concerts, particularly trumpet and organ performances, and provides a quiet space for reflection and prayer.
